WebMaximum Credit for 2016. $6,269 with three or more qualifying children. $5,572 with two qualifying children. $3,373 with one qualifying child. $506 with no qualifying children. WebThe Earned Income Tax Credit - EIC or EITC - is a refundable tax credit for taxpayers who have low or moderate incomes. This credit is meant to supplement your earned income, which is income you have earned by working for someone else - employment or W-2 income or being self-employed. Are You Eligible for the EITC?
